How to fill out will making guide

Illustration
01
Gather necessary information: Before starting to fill out a will making guide, gather all the necessary information, such as personal details, assets and properties, and potential beneficiaries.
02
Choose an approach: Determine the approach you want to take in creating your will making guide. You can either use a DIY guide or seek professional assistance from an attorney or estate planner.
03
Start with the basics: Begin by providing your full legal name, address, and contact information. This information is crucial for identifying you as the creator of the will.
04
Appoint an executor: Decide who will be responsible for executing your will and handling your affairs after your passing. It's important to choose someone whom you trust and who has the ability to fulfill this role effectively.
05
Outline your assets and debts: List down all your assets, including but not limited to real estate, bank accounts, investment portfolios, vehicles, and personal belongings. Also, mention any outstanding debts, loans, or mortgages.
06
Determine beneficiaries: Clearly state who will inherit your assets, properties, and possessions. You can specify different beneficiaries for different assets or divide your estate equally among your loved ones. Consider potential contingencies, such as what should happen if a beneficiary predeceases you.
07
Include specific bequests: If you have specific items or heirlooms you wish to leave to specific individuals, make sure to mention them in your will making guide. This could include sentimental objects, valuable jewelry, or family heirlooms.
08
Consider tax implications: If you have a significant estate, it's important to consider the potential tax implications. Consult with a tax advisor or estate planner to ensure that your assets are distributed in the most tax-efficient manner.
09
Sign and date the will: Once you have completed your will making guide, review it thoroughly to ensure accuracy and legality. Sign the document in the presence of witnesses as per the legal requirements of your jurisdiction. Keep a copy in a safe and accessible place, such as a secure file or safe deposit box.

Who needs will making guide?

01
Individuals who want to ensure that their assets are distributed according to their wishes after their passing.
02
People with significant assets or complicated family situations that may require specific instructions in their will.
03
Anyone who wants to avoid potential family disputes or conflicts over the division of their estate.
04
Parents or guardians who want to appoint a legal guardian for their minor children in the event of their death.
05
Individuals who want to minimize the tax burden on their estate and ensure their assets are distributed efficiently.
06
Those who want to leave specific instructions for the care of their pets or other dependents.
07
Business owners who want to designate someone to manage their business after their death.
